
电脑
题目中信息不完整,我尝试进行一些推测。除了容量上的显著差异,内存配置还会影响性能表现。假设你使用的是一个双通道、四插槽的系统。如果你目前有两根16GB内存组成32GB,升级为四根16GB内存形成64GB,这种情况下性能可能会下降。因为从两根内存升级到四根内存时,系统会采用2DPC(每通道两条DIMM)的配置,而这种配置通常需要降低内存频率以保证稳定性,从而导致性能损失。如果将两根16GB内存升级为两根32GB内存,虽然内存条数量没有变化,但单根内存可能从single-rank变为dual-rank。这种情况下,整体性能会有所提升。原因在于,两根内存一般不会插入同一个通道(以避免降速)。如果是两根single-rank内存,分别插在两个通道上,只能实现channel interleaving(通道交织),无法实现chip-select interleaving(芯片选择交织)。而当内存升级为dual-rank后,在channel interleaving的基础上还能进一步实现chip-select interleaving,从而提升性能。如果从单根32GB内存升级为单根64GB内存,大概率也会从single-rank变为dual-rank,同样可以享受到chip-select interleaving带来的性能提升。然而,如果你从两根16GB的single-rank内存升级到两根32GB的single-rank内存(理论上存在这种情况,RDIMM支持这种规格,而UDIMM目前市场较少见),那么性能几乎不会发生变化,因为rank结构没有改变,交织方式也没有改进。以上讨论涉及一些专业术语,如2DPC、interleaving等,相关内容可参考之前的文章链接。- 为什么
电脑不能插四条内存却设计四个插槽? - Shannon的回答 - 网络- 如何理解地址交织 address interleaving - Shannon的文章 - 网络